Interoperability standards, soa and the e-framework

2 Overview Your project, soa and interoperability standards  Interoperability revisited  Focusing on services rather than applications How to find relevant technology and make it available; the e-framework  Hands on with the eframework A development dialog: the development table  Pulling all the leads together

3 Introduction A software system doesn't live in isolation, it needs to work with other systems How to find useful technology, and make your own available to others: e-framework and development table

4 No interoperability

5 Custom interoperability

6 Interoperability data standards

7 Interoperable services

8 Services and your project Which systems (inside and outside the firewall) does your tool need to interoperate with? Which systems could it interoperate with in order to delegate functionality? What services (from inside and outside the firewall) are already there? Which service components can I beg, borrow and steal?

9 Services and the e-framework For JISC:  Aims to put service standards and solutions in a common framework for education and research  International partnership  A way to coordinate approaches across development programmes For you:  A way of finding service components and soa solutions  A way of making your developments available

10 e-framework hands-on Consider all the service components your projects uses or makes available tag them with the e-framework vocabulary give them two sentence descriptions

11 Development table  Records pointers to relevant services, standards, tools and existing project work  Establishes a dialog about a project's development:  ‘Strand Support Teams’ looks at project plans  Strand Support Teams have a first go at completing a ‘Development Table’ for each project  Development table is sent back to projects for comment and completion  Wrap-up by support team and project
